1from transformers import AutoTokenizer, AutoModelForCausalLM
2import torch
3
4# Load model and tokenizer
5model_name = "anhtuan15082023/gemma-3n-vneid-merged"
6tokenizer = AutoTokenizer.from_pretrained(model_name)
7model = AutoModelForCausalLM.from_pretrained(
8 model_name,
9 torch_dtype=torch.float16,
10 device_map="auto",
11 trust_remote_code=True
12)
13
14# Generate Vietnamese text
15def generate_vietnamese_text(prompt, max_length=100):
16 inputs = tokenizer(prompt, return_tensors="pt")
17
18 with torch.no_grad():
19 outputs = model.generate(
20 **inputs,
21 max_length=max_length,
22 temperature=0.7,
23 do_sample=True,
24 top_p=0.9,
25 pad_token_id=tokenizer.eos_token_id
26 )
27
28 response = tokenizer.decode(outputs[0], skip_special_tokens=True)
29 return response[len(prompt):].strip()
30
31# Example usage
32prompt = "Xin chào, tôi là"
33result = generate_vietnamese_text(prompt)
34print(f"Input: {prompt}")
